Department of Psychology
Study Abroad Scholarship


A $3,000 scholarship awarded to an outstanding Psychology major who is studying abroad at an exchange partner university in the United Kingdom for a semester or year.

REQUIRED ELIGIBILITY
  • 3.0 cumulative GPA or higher preferred
     
  • Declared psychology major at time of application
     
  • Acceptance into a study abroad program at an exchange partner in the United Kingdom

PREFERRED ELIGIBILITY
  • Demonstrated financial need as determined by the Office of Student Financial Aid

APPLICATION REQUIREMENTS
Complete the online application by clicking "Apply Now" above. This application requires:
  • 300-500 word essay describing what motivates you to study abroad, what you hope to gain from the experience, and how it might relate to your future academic and/or career goals. You will also need to include a description of any extracurricular activities you are involved in on campus.
     
  • One to two letters of recommendation from current or former college faculty members (to be requested electronically)
